Trade, investment and defence cooperation high on agenda of Japanese PM's discussions with Indian leaders

Trade, investment, security and defence cooperation are high on the agenda of Japanese Prime Minister Yukio Hatoyama’s discussions with Indian leaders. The visiting dignitary met Prime Minister Dr Manmohan Singh at his residence and exchanged views on a host of issues. The UPA Chairperson, Mrs. Sonia Gandhi also called on him. AIR correspondent reports that today’s summit meeting between the Prime Minister Dr. Manmohan Singh and his Japanese counterpart is expected to give a new momentum to bilateral ties.<br/><br/>Ahead of arriving in the national capital on Monday, the Japanese Prime Minister visited Mumbai. During his meetings with captains of Indian industry in Mumbai, Mr Hatoyama stressed the need to intensify bilateral trade with India, particularly in infrastructure and technology.<br/><br/><br/>
